Preparation steps

  1. blitz jalapeño, onion, oregano and spring onions until finely chopped
  2. fry pancetta in 2 tbsp olive oil until it starts to brown
  3. fry pork shoulder for 6 minutes until lightly browned
  4. add chilli base and fry for 8 minutes stirring now and then
  5. add lime halves, chicken stock and simmer, then simmer covered for 70 minutes
  6. stir 2 tbsp olive oil into the reserved jalapeño and onion mixture
  7. stir reserved chilli base and chopped coriander into the chilli
  8. heat oven to 190°C, grease and line a 22cm cake tin
  9. blitz cornbread ingredients until well combined and pour into the tin
  10. bake for 25 minutes at 190°C
  11. turn down heat to 170°C and bake for 6 minutes more
  12. serve the chilli from the pan with warm cornbread alongside
